JOB OVERVIEW:
Library Assistant, Indigenous & IDEA


Reporting to the Library Supervisor, the Library Assistant, Indigenous & IDEA (Inclusion, Diversity, Equity, Access) focus will provide support for the Library efforts surrounding equity, diversity, inclusion, Indigenization, decolonization, reconciliation.


EDUCATION AND EXPERIENCE

  • Completion of a twoyear Library Technician diploma from a publicly accredited post
- secondary institution or combination of equivalent education, training and experience.

  • Background in equity, diversity, inclusion, Indigenization, decolonization, reconciliation or lived experience.
  • An understanding of Brian Deer classification is preferred.
  • Relevant communitybased and/or professional experience rooted in Indigenous communities, knowledges, and traditions is preferred.
  • Training or experience in accessibility requirements for online resources.

QUALIFICATIONS

  • Excellent oral and written communication skills including the ability to present information in a clear and concise manner.
  • Excellent organizational and time management skills, demonstrated attention to detail.
  • Knowledge/training in digital or physical accessibility and/or IDEA issues would be an asset.
  • Demonstrated keyboarding skills, understanding of computer concepts and terminology, and experience with word processing software and file management systems
  • Demonstrated experience at a basic skill level in Microsoft Excel or similar spreadsheet software.
  • Ability to interact effectively with a variety of individuals with diverse backgrounds and needs.
  • Ability to lift 3050 pounds and move materials on carts.
